Which construction companies in Indiana sponsor F-1 CPT visas?
Indiana-based and regional firms with established university hiring programs are the most consistent CPT sponsors. Companies like Pepper Construction, Shiel Sexton, Messer Construction, and Hagerman Group have hired construction management and civil engineering students through internship programs. Larger general contractors and engineering firms tend to have formal CPT processes in place, while smaller subcontractors are less likely to have the HR infrastructure to support it.
Which cities in Indiana have the most construction F-1 CPT sponsorship jobs?
Indianapolis generates the highest concentration of construction CPT opportunities, driven by commercial development, healthcare facility construction, and public infrastructure projects. Fort Wayne is a secondary hub with active commercial and industrial building activity. The northwest Indiana corridor, particularly around Valparaiso and Merrillville, benefits from proximity to Chicago-area construction markets and hosts operations for several large regional contractors.
What types of construction roles typically qualify for F-1 CPT sponsorship in Indiana?
Roles that align directly with a student's degree program are eligible for CPT authorization. In construction, this typically includes project engineering internships, estimating and scheduling positions, construction management roles, and site supervision support. Civil and structural engineering positions tied to an engineering degree also qualify. Purely manual or trade labor roles generally do not meet the CPT requirement of being an integral part of an established curriculum.

Are there any Indiana-specific considerations for F-1 CPT in the construction industry?
Indiana's construction sector is heavily tied to commercial real estate cycles and state infrastructure spending, which means CPT availability can shift with project pipelines. Students at Purdue University, Indiana University-Purdue University Indianapolis (IUPUI), and Ball State University benefit from employer familiarity with CPT processes through established career services offices. Confirming that your Designated School Official has authorized CPT for the specific employer and start date before accepting any offer is essential.
